Subject: [ANNOUNCE] new PM branch, rebased to current master
Date: Wed, 16 Dec 2009 11:45:16 -0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<873a3abt4j.fsf@deeprootsystems.com> (raw)
Hello,
I've just pushed the latest PM branch. As usual, all the gory details
can be found on the wiki[1], but I'll highlight the important changes
here:
- PM branch getting smaller: The off-mode support and CPUidle support
is now in mainline, so it's no longer in PM branch.
- omap3_pm_defconfig: now works an all supported boards. I moved to
the new DEBUG_LL_NONE so all boards should work out of the box without
having to switch DEBUG_LL_UART* setup.
- voltage_off_while_idle: only modifies the VOLTCTRL reg during OFF
transitions instead of when debugfs file is changed
Otherwise, this is primarily a rebase and inclusion of several
patches/fixes from the mailing list.
The biggest change is on how the PM branch will be managed. As of
this release, the PM branch will no longer be continually rebased.
Instead, it will remain mergable. I will be rebuilding the PM
branch in a similar way that Tony is now doing the master branch.
